Q: Is 9,695,894 a Prime Number?
A: No, 9,695,894 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 9695894 can be evenly divided by 1 2 13 26 83 166 1,079 2,158 4,493 8,986 58,409 116,818 372,919 745,838 4,847,947 and 9,695,894, with no remainder.
Since 9,695,894 cannot be divided by just 1 and 9,695,894, it is not a prime number.
